Immigrant Petitions for Foreign Workers
In our international economy, talented job applicants come from all over the
globe. U.S. companies can extend permanent job offers to foreign
nationals, but in most cases, there is a long application process before
permanent employment can begin. The employment-based green card process
requires careful and early planning.
Permanent Job Offers and Labor Certification
For most employment-based immigrant petitions, the employer must first obtain an
approved labor certification from the U.S. Department of
Labor. The employer must then file a Form I-140 Petition with USCIS,
detailing the permanent, full-time job offer.
What categories require labor
certification?
An approved labor certification is required for each of the following job categories:
- EB-3 Professionals. Applicants in this category must hold a U.S. baccalaureate degree or foreign equivalent degree that is normally required for the profession. In some cases, a combination of education and experience may be substituted for the degree.
- EB-2 Advance Degree Professionals. Applicants in this category must hold at least a U.S. masters degree or foreign equivalent degree. The advanced degree must be one confered by an accredited university and may not be substituted by combining education and experience.
- EB-3 Skilled Workers. These positions are not seasonal or temporary and require at least two years of experience or training. The training requirement may be met through relevant post-secondary education.
- EB-3 Other Workers. This cateogry includes positions that require less than two years of higher education, training, or experience. However, due to the long backlog, you should expect to wait many years before being granted a visa under this category.
USCIS will review whether the employer has the
financial ability to pay the offered wage specified in the labor certification,
as supported by the employer's federal tax return or audited financial
statements, as well as the employee's payroll records. The petition must also
include evidence demonstrating the employee meets all of the job requirements
specified in the labor certification.
Exempt Categories
There are several other employment-based immigrant categories that are exempt
from the labor certification requirement. These include:
Extraodrinary Achievements
Individuals who have demonstated a sustained record of achievements in their field may be exempted from the labor certification requirement and may also be
eligible to self-petition for a green card. Additional details are listed

Multinational Managers and Executives
Multinational corporations can transfer their executives and managers to the U.S. and sponsor them for permenant residence without the hassle of labor certification. Additional details are listed in the

EB-5 Investor Program
The EB-5 category is for immigrant investors who have met strict job creation and
investment level requirements. Petitioners must demonstrate the source of their
$1 million funds (or $500,000 for certain designated areas of high unemployment)
and that the investment funds have been placed at risk in creating 10 full-time
jobs. The government has reported a high level of fraud in this category, and it
is strongly recommended that you consult
with a qualified immigration attorney before investing.
